The Importance of Fume Hood Systems in Modern Laboratories

Fume hoods are essential for maintaining indoor air quality in laboratories where chemicals, biological materials, or volatile substances are handled. These systems work by capturing, containing, and expelling harmful emissions, preventing exposure that could lead to health risks or contamination.

Improper or poorly installed fume hoods can compromise safety, leading to hazardous working conditions. According to industry best practices, fume hoods must meet global performance standards such as ANSI/ASHRAE 110 and EN 14175, ensuring proper airflow, containment efficiency, and operational reliability.

Types of Fume Hoods and Their Applications

Selecting the right type of fume hood is critical to achieving optimal safety and performance. The two primary types include ducted and ductless fume hoods.

Ducted fume hoods are connected to an external exhaust system, making them ideal for handling high volumes of hazardous chemicals. They provide continuous airflow and are commonly used in industrial laboratories and research facilities.

Ductless fume hoods, on the other hand, use advanced filtration systems such as HEPA or carbon filters to purify air before recirculating it back into the laboratory. These are suitable for environments with limited infrastructure or specific filtration needs.

The Fume Hood Installation Process

Effective fume hood installation is a comprehensive process that goes far beyond placing equipment in a laboratory. It involves detailed planning, engineering, and validation to ensure optimal performance.

The process typically begins with a site evaluation, where experts analyze the laboratory layout, airflow dynamics, and safety requirements. This is followed by airflow planning and system design, ensuring that the hood integrates seamlessly with existing HVAC systems.

Custom sizing and material selection are also critical steps. High-quality fume hoods are constructed using corrosion-resistant materials and equipped with advanced features such as airflow sensors, ergonomic sashes, and filtration modules.

Once installed, the system undergoes rigorous testing and validation to confirm compliance with safety standards. This includes airflow testing, containment verification, and certification.
